The quest for unbiased spatial proteomic discovery is critical in understanding the complex microenvironments within biological tissues. Traditional methods like proximity labeling and Laser Capture Microdissection (LCM) have their limitations: proximity labeling suffers from sample restriction (non-human models) and can lead to biased results due to incomplete labeling, while LCM is laborious and often lacks the precision needed for single-cell resolution.

  • Technical Insights: Learn how Microscoop Mint achieves spatial protein purification by introducing in situ subcellular photo-biotinylation of proteins at user-defined regions of interest (ROIs) one field of view (FOV) at a time for thousands of FOVs fully automatically. With mass spectrometry, Microscoop enables the discovery of subcellular proteomes in high sensitivity, specificity, and resolution.
